AceShowbiz - A teaser trailer for "Sing" is here for anyone who wonders what "American Idol" looks like in a world entirely inhabited by animals. Dropped online Monday, February 15, the video finds a Koala named Buster Moon (Matthew McConaughey) holding an audition for a singing competition that he hopes will save a theater he owns.

Soon, every animal in the town becomes aware of the competition and lines up outside the theater to show off their talent in front of Buster. We get to see various animals like a pig, a sheep, some rabbits and a snail singing familiar tunes like Lady GaGa's "Bad Romance" and Nicki Minaj's "Anaconda".

Written and directed by Garth Jennings, who's worked on music videos for the likes of Radiohead, Vampire Weekend, Beck and Blur, "Sing" will center on Buster as he tries to produce the world's greatest singing competition and the five lead contestants that include a mouse (Seth MacFarlane), who croons as smoothly as he cons, a timid teenage elephant (Tori Kelly), who has an enormous case of stage fright, a mother (Reese Witherspoon) with 25 piglets, a young gangster gorilla (Taron Egerton) looking to break free of his family's felonies, and a punk-rock porcupine (Scarlett Johansson), who struggles to shed her arrogant boyfriend and go solo.

The animated flick is set to arrive in U.S. theaters on December 21.
